STARTING PROCEDURES<br />

Before starting your vehicle, adjust your seat, adjust both<br />

inside and outside mirrors, and fasten your seat belts.<br />

WARNING!<br />

Be sure to turn off the engine and remove the key<br />

from the ignition switch if you want to rest or sleep<br />

in your car. Accidents can be caused by inadvertently<br />

moving the gear selection lever or by pressing the<br />

accelerator pedal. This may cause excessive heat in<br />

the exhaust system, resulting in overheating and<br />

vehicle fire which may cause serious or fatal injuries.<br />

WARNING!<br />

Do not leave children or animals inside parked<br />

vehicles in hot weather. Interior heat build up may<br />

cause serious injury or death.<br />

Automatic Transmission<br />

Start the engine with the selector lever in NEUTRAL or<br />

PARK position. Apply the brake before shifting to any<br />

driving range.<br />

Normal Starting<br />

Normal Starting of either a warm or cold engine is<br />

obtained without pumping or depressing the accelerator<br />

pedal.<br />
